HOLA TODOS.
Busco alguna manera de indexar con algo asi como una CLAUSULA TOKEN.
Mi necesidad es que el usuario captura una palabra y se muestren RAPIDAMENTE todos aquellos registros que contienen dicha palabra en un campo especifico.
ALGUNA IDEA?
token index
- Arturo Lopesoria
- Posts: 84
- Joined: Fri Aug 10, 2007 1:47 am
- Location: Mexico DF
- Contact:
token index
Arturo LS
- Antonio Linares
- Site Admin
- Posts: 37481
- Joined: Thu Oct 06, 2005 5:47 pm
- Location: Spain
- Contact:
Arturo,
Si usas relativamente pocos registros entonces puedes usar SET FILTER TO ... que es algo lento ya que busca registro por registro.
Si tu DBF es bien grande, entonces podemos indicarte otras técnicas para hacer las busquedas más rápidas, como crear un índice temporal condicional ó buscar directamente dentro de la DBF usando At().
Si usas relativamente pocos registros entonces puedes usar SET FILTER TO ... que es algo lento ya que busca registro por registro.
Si tu DBF es bien grande, entonces podemos indicarte otras técnicas para hacer las busquedas más rápidas, como crear un índice temporal condicional ó buscar directamente dentro de la DBF usando At().
- Arturo Lopesoria
- Posts: 84
- Joined: Fri Aug 10, 2007 1:47 am
- Location: Mexico DF
- Contact:
Gracias Antonio. Actualmente uso un indice temporal que resulta mas veloz que un SET FILTER en combinacion con AT() o "$", pero aun asi resulta lento, pues son muchos registros.
Recuerdo habia una clausula token en algun RDD, la verdad creo que unicamente algo asi podria aumentar la velocidad de respuesta.
GRACIAS. SALUDOS!
Recuerdo habia una clausula token en algun RDD, la verdad creo que unicamente algo asi podria aumentar la velocidad de respuesta.
GRACIAS. SALUDOS!
Antonio Linares wrote:Arturo,
Si usas relativamente pocos registros entonces puedes usar SET FILTER TO ... que es algo lento ya que busca registro por registro.
Si tu DBF es bien grande, entonces podemos indicarte otras técnicas para hacer las busquedas más rápidas, como crear un índice temporal condicional ó buscar directamente dentro de la DBF usando At().
Arturo LS